quote:

The day when judging two teams based how they faired against a third team, instead of how they did against one another, is a dark retarded day


A hypothetical:

Team A is 0-7 and has lost every game by 20+ points.
Team B is 7-0 and has won every game by 20+ points.

They both have a common opponent.

Team A then beats Team B in a driving rainstorm 3-0.

Do you rank Team A above Team B, just because of the head-to-head victory???

Of course not, you must consider the entire body of work of a team. Sure, head-to-head games are very important, but they can also be an aberration.
